Job description

As a MEMS Fabrication Technician, you play a key role in developing, optimizing and supporting advanced cleanroom fabrication processes for cutting-edge MEMS technologies. Your work contributes to a wide range of applications, including electron optics, acoustics, photonics, microscopy and imaging.

Your work focuses on executing and continuously improving a broad range of cleanroom processes, including wet-chemical processing (such as wet etching, sample cleaning and lift-off), conductive and non-conductive coating, optical, laser and electron beam lithography, reactive ion etching (RIE and DRIE), stacking, alignment, bonding and wire bonding. You monitor process quality, investigate deviations and identify opportunities to improve reliability, reproducibility and efficiency.

You work closely with principal investigators, postdoctoral researchers, PhD candidates and fellow cleanroom specialists to support research projects. You also provide hands-on technical support to researchers, students and industrial users, helping them successfully use the cleanroom facilities and fabrication technologies.

An important part of your role is sharing knowledge and enabling others to succeed. You train and guide new users in approved cleanroom procedures, contribute to a safe and efficient working environment, and help ensure the reliability of cleanroom equipment and fabrication processes. You understand that groundbreaking research depends on both discipline and creativity: strict adherence to cleanroom protocols provides the foundation that allows researchers the freedom to explore, experiment and innovate with confidence. This position offers the opportunity to work at the interface of academic research and industrial innovation. Acting as the bridge between the Imaging Physics department and our two cleanroom facilities, Else Kooi Laboratories and Kavli Nanolab., you connect researchers with the technical expertise and infrastructure needed to turn ambitious ideas into reality.

    Faculty Applied Sciences

    With more than 1,100 employees, including 150 pioneering principal investigators, as well as a population of about 3,600 passionate students, the Faculty of Applied Sciences is an inspiring scientific ecosystem. Focusing on key enabling technologies, such as quantum- and nanotechnology, photonics, biotechnology, synthetic biology and materials for energy storage and conversion, our faculty aims to provide solutions to important problems of the 21st century. To that end, we educate innovative students in broad Bachelor’s and specialist Master’s programmes with a strong research component.
